Year Number 1996 45.9016380310059 1998 45.3551902770996 2000 44.8087425231934 2002 24.3243236541748 2003 25.4054050445557 2004 21.3930339813232 2005 23.0392150878906 2006 21.463415145874 2007 33.009708404541 2008 33.980583190918 2009 37.3205757141113 2010 39.2344512939453 2011 40.2843589782715 2012 37.9146919250488 2013 36.0189590454102 2014 25.480770111084 2015 25.238094329834 2016 21.9047622680664 2017 23.8095245361328 2018 20.4761905670166 2019 20.9523811340332 2020 19.5238094329834 2021 21.4285717010498 2022 20.7547168731689